In a significant development for the tech industry, Nvidia, a leader in artificial intelligence hardware, is expanding its influence beyond its well-known graphics processing units. The company is increasingly shaping the architecture of data centers, essential infrastructures where AI applications are both developed and deployed. Nvidia's shift into designing data centers marks a crucial expansion in its business strategy. Traditionally known for its high-performance GPUs, which are integral to AI computations, Nvidia is now leveraging its expertise to influence the very environment where these calculations take place. This move includes collaborating with cloud service providers, technology integrators, and other key players in the data center ecosystem.As AI continues to evolve, the demand for optimized data centers—facilities specifically tailored to handle AI workloads efficiently—is burgeoning. The design and operation of these centers are critical because they directly affect the performance, energy efficiency, and scalability of AI applications. With its deep understanding of AI workloads and computational requirements, Nvidia is uniquely positioned to offer insights and innovations that enhance data center designs. By doing so, the company not only expands its market reach but also sets new standards for AI infrastructure, potentially influencing the entire AI-driven technology sector. Nvidia’s strategy includes forging strong relationships with leading cloud service providers. These partnerships are crucial because they allow Nvidia to test and implement its designs on a massive scale, ensuring that its innovations effectively meet the needs of large-scale AI operations. Additionally, these collaborations facilitate the integration of Nvidia’s AI-centric hardware and software solutions, creating a seamless and optimized environment for AI applications. The AI and data center markets are experiencing rapid growth, driven by increasing demand for AI-powered applications across various industries, from healthcare to finance. Nvidia’s involvement in data center design positions it as a pivotal player in these burgeoning markets. As companies seek to enhance their AI capabilities, Nvidia’s comprehensive solutions—from GPUs to data center blueprints—offer a one-stop shop for cutting-edge AI infrastructure. Moreover, Nvidia's advancements could drive competition within the industry, prompting other hardware and cloud service providers to innovate and adapt to the new standards Nvidia is setting. This competitive dynamic is likely to accelerate technological advancements, benefiting the broader AI ecosystem. The integration of Nvidia’s hardware, particularly GPUs designed for AI processing, into data center architecture is expected to bring several benefits. These include improved computational efficiency, reduced latency, and enhanced energy efficiency—all critical factors for the successful deployment of AI applications. Moreover, Nvidia's continuous innovations in AI hardware, such as the development of more powerful and efficient GPUs, will likely be incorporated into its data center designs. This synergy between hardware and infrastructure not only maximizes performance but also ensures future-proofing against the ever-evolving demands of AI technologies. Nvidia's expanding role in the design of data centers represents a strategic move that underscores its commitment to leading the AI revolution. By influencing the very environments where AI is nurtured and applied, Nvidia is set to play an instrumental role in shaping the future of AI technology.
